Cardiac Arrest
A medical emergency where the heart suddenly stops beating, leading to a cessation of blood flow to the brain and other vital organs.
Heart Failure
A medical condition where the heart is unable to pump sufficiently to maintain blood flow to meet the body's needs.
Heart Attack
A medical condition that occurs when the blood flow to a part of the heart is blocked for a long enough time to cause damage or death to heart muscle.
Hypertension
A chronic medical condition where the blood pressure in the arteries is persistently elevated.
